Principal Engineer

Microsoft Microsoft · Big Tech · Bengaluru, KA, IN +1 · Software Engineering

The Principal Engineer will tech lead and develop features related to scale and resiliency for the Microsoft Fabric platform, focusing on compute infrastructure and AI solutions. This role involves creating high-level designs, analyzing incidents, and solving performance issues within a high-scale, cloud-based environment.

What you'd actually do

  1. Tech lead and develop features related to scale and resiliency for Fabric Platform.
  2. Create high level design and architecture for some of the features within Fabric Platform.
  3. Analyze data and come up with solutions related to incidents and scale/reliability.
  4. Lead and develop AI solutions for Fabric Core Platform.

Skills

Required

  • 12+ years of coding as a developer on backend of a product
  • 10+ years as developer of cloud services
  • 5+ years experience with debugging and developing high scale high throughput cloud services
  • 5+ years experience with architecture and high level design of high scale cloud services
  • 5+ years experience with solving latency and performance issues
  • 1+ years experience with using and developing AI

Nice to have

  • Experience with Azure technologies is a plus
  • Experience with Azure infrastructure is a plus
  • Experience with Azure SQL and CosmosDB

What the JD emphasized

  • high scale and resiliency
  • high scale high throughput service
  • high scale cloud services
  • high scale high throughput cloud services
  • solving latency and performance issues
  • using and developing AI

Other signals

  • AI platform
  • Compute infrastructure
  • High scale and resiliency
  • AI solutions for Fabric Core Platform